Mother/ daughter attempted murder case postponed

A case in which a mother is alleged to have hired a hit man to eliminate her daughter was postponed yesterday due to the ill-health of the presiding magistrate Taboka Slave.

The case was supposed to proceed yesterday at the Broadhurst Magistrate Court. Previously the court heard how Motlalepula Monareng had hired hit men to kill her 32 year-old daughter, Dolly Monareng.

The court learnt that she had offered the hit men P100,000 for the job and was about to pay a P40,000 deposit when the police pounced on her and foiled the plot. One of the alleged assassins, Benny Modisane, was to kill Dolly and her boyfriend. The mother met Modisane and another hit man who was to procure a gun and but when she was about to produce the deposit the police pounced.
